Project Drawdown defines alternative cement as: the use of an increased percentage of fly ash instead of Portland cement in concrete. This practice replaces the use of conventional concrete made primarily of Portland cement. At the cement production factory, the proportions of the various raw materials that go into cement must be checked to achieve a consistent kiln feed, and samples of the mix are frequently examined using Xray fluorescence analysis.

Concrete production is the process of mixing together the various ingredients—water, aggregate, cement, and any additives—to produce concrete. Concrete production is timesensitive. Once the ingredients are mixed, workers must put the concrete in place before it hardens.

It is undesirable to obtain a high degree of variation in between batches of cement produced from the same raw material source. In order to avoid potential problems occurring with the variable quality of cement, quality control (QC) should be performed at various stages during the cement production .

The cement industry has for some time been seeking alternative raw material for the Portland cement clinker production. The aim of this research was to investigate the possibility of utilizing iron ore tailings (IOT) to replace clay as aluminasilicate raw material for the production of Portland cement clinker. Raw Materials for Cement. Raw materials for cement such as limestone, clay, shale, etc. are extracted by blasting or scraping with shearer loaders. The material is then delivered to the crusher, where it is reduced to small pieces by crushing or pounding.

Aug 30, 2012· Cement Manufacturing Process Phase 1: Raw Material Extraction. Cement uses raw materials that cover calcium, silicon, iron and aluminum. Such raw materials are limestone, clay and sand. Limestone is for calcium. It is combined with much smaller proportions of sand and clay. Sand clay fulfill the need of silicon, iron and aluminum.

Cement is a binder used for construction that sets, hardens and adheres to other materials. Cement is seldom used on its own, but rather to bind sand and gravel (aggregate) together. The cement industry is the building block of the construction industry. Few construction projects can take place without utilizing cement somewhere in the design.
